Historical Evolution of Naval Logistics Practices

Naval logistics practices have undergone significant transformations throughout history, evolving from rudimentary supply methods to complex systems crucial for modern military operations. Initially, logistics relied on locally sourced provisions and manual transport, often hampered by limited resources and communication difficulties.

With the advent of sailing ships in the Age of Exploration, naval logistics began to incorporate organized supply chains. Navies started establishing designated naval bases, allowing for better management of resources and support to vessels at sea. The Industrial Revolution further advanced these practices, introducing steam-powered ships and mechanized supply processes.

World Wars I and II marked a pivotal point in naval logistics and support, as extensive supply networks became vital to sustain large fleets. Innovations in transportation and communication enabled real-time coordination, allowing navies to project power globally while maintaining operational readiness.

In contemporary naval operations, advanced technology and strategic planning continue to refine logistics. This historical evolution illustrates the critical role of naval logistics in ensuring the effectiveness and sustainability of naval vessels in defense scenarios.

Case Studies of Successful Naval Logistics Operations

Successful naval logistics operations have consistently demonstrated the critical role of effective support in military readiness. One prominent case is Operation Desert Storm, which showcased rapid deployment capabilities and logistical coordination across multiple naval vessels. This operation illustrated the importance of timely supply deliveries and personnel transportation, ensuring mission success.

Another significant instance is the U.S. Navy’s humanitarian assistance during the 2004 Indian Ocean tsunami. The logistics team managed to mobilize several naval vessels quickly to deliver essential supplies and medical care. This operation emphasized the ability of naval logistics and support to adapt to unforeseen challenges while addressing urgent humanitarian needs.

In both cases, the integration of supply chain management with robust maintenance and support services proved instrumental. These historical examples highlight the effectiveness of strategic planning and execution in enhancing naval operational capabilities, ultimately affirming the significance of naval logistics and support in military operations.
